Proceeding contribution from Kevin Bonavia (Labour) in the House of Commons on Monday, 2 March 2026. It occurred during Debate on bill on Representation of the People Bill.


Representation of the People Bill

The shadow Secretary of State has asked, on a number of occasions, whether we agree with his so-called legal definition. The legal definition is always for the purposes of the law for which it is intended, so the Children Act definition is for the purposes of that Act, and what we are debating today is for the purposes of voting.
